Urban gospel sensation, Priscilla Otumfuo, has released a new single 'Wave' after a long wait.
After winning the hearts of Ghanaians with her 2019 single ‘Worthy is the Lamb’, she is serving fans again with another spirit-filled song.
'Wave', a worship song calls the attention of God and his spirit to fill and manifest in the lives of every believer.
